  • Patent number: 8559535
    Abstract: In a relay scheme, a wireless source apparatus, a wireless destination apparatus and a wireless relay apparatus cooperate for handling transmission failures by space/time diverse channels. In the case of the successful direct transmission, reduced or no additional overhead for the relay selection is incurred. Thus, for a good SNR between source and destination, the inventive protocol has similar performance as a standard approach. In the case of a transmission failure e.g., due to small scale fading, a transmission via a different communication path implementing spatial diversity via a selected relay is supported. The device is to only activate the overhearing of signals in case of weak signal quality between sender and receiver. This selection of relay devices is done by demand only. A specific protocol for the reservation of the wireless medium for the entire cooperative communication has been specified.

  • Patent number: 7848706
    Abstract: A receiver includes a receiving unit for scanning a dedicated signaling channel for the presence of an announcement signal. The announcement signal indicates a transmitter willing to access a transmission medium. The receiving unit is further operative to receive a data signal from a further transmitter on a dedicated traffic channel. Furthermore, the receiver includes an interference estimator for estimating, whether an interference caused by a new transmitter is allowable or not. A processor is provided for applying an interference counter-measure, when the interference is not allowable. A transmitter can, without any limitation, transmit the announcement signal. The transmitter will start transmitting, when it receives a ready-to-receive signal from the addressed receiver and when it does not receive an objection tone from another receiver in the network.
